Veteran Actor & Former Union Minister Krishnam Raju No More

Guwahati: Veteran Telugu actor and former union minister Krishnam Raju passed away at the age of 83 on Sunday morning in Hyderabad.

He was undergoing treatment at a private facility in Hyderabad for health issues. In a few days, the politician-turned-actor was supposed to be released from the hospital. However, his health did not get any better.

Notably, Atal Bihari Vajpayee, the former prime minister of India, appointed Krishnam Raju as the nation’s first actor to hold the position of Union Minister.

Krishnam Raju, also known as Rebel Star, had a successful career in both politics and the film industry. He last appeared as the spiritual guru in Radhe Syam, a pan-Indian movie starring Prabhas.

He started his career in Telugu movies in 1966 after serving as a journalist for a short while. He first appeared as a villain, but he quickly began playing the main protagonist.

Meanwhile, the Southern film industry expressed its sorrow at the actor and politician’s passing.
